Help moving Crown PW3500 - dead in corner

Looking for any help temporarily disabling brake on Crown PW3500 Serial number 6a199122 to roll it about 20 ft so I can get a forklift to it.

Unit has been dead for years according to the other staff and I just took over this part of the business and need to clear this part of the warehouse to reorganize our storage. Somebody basically backed it up almost to the wall between two large shelf units. There's enough space to walk to the back but not enough to get around it to lift it.

All the work we do now is basically normal pallet jack stuff and I need to get rid of this unit but it won't take a charge and I can't figure out how to get the brake released to roll it out of the corner. All the online searches describe physical layouts that don't seem to fit what I see opening the clamshell.

So if anybody can tell me how to temporarily disable the brake, provide a diagram or whatever appreciated. I've got a new job coming in soon and need to basically re-order the whole area and this thing is in the way. I'm a competent mechanical guy but never worked with an electric jack before.

Need to release the tension on the brake. i'll add a picture for reference. you'll need to apply tension to release the brake so tightening the bolt should move the arm in and release the brake. might need a bump to start since it may be rusted/ corroded in place.
